Communication Design Quarterly, Issue 8.4<http://sigdoc.acm.org/blog/2020/12/14/cdq-issue-8-4-is-now-live/> (sigdoc.acm.org/blog/2020/12/14/cdq-issue-8-4-is-now-live/) is now available on the SIGDOC website!

This issue features two articles previously published through our online first model:

  *   Political Technical Communication and Ideographic Communication Design in a Pre-digital Congressional Campaign by Ryan Cheek
  *   Hybrid Collectivity: Hacking Environmental Risk Visualization for the Anthropocene by Lynda Olman and Danielle DeVasto


The issue also includes Bremen Vance and Lauren Malone's new book review of Rhetoric Technology and the Virtues.
